EDUCATION SERVICES TO SEE MORE SHORTING ACTIVITY - S3 PARTNERS
Healthcare educator Adtalem Global's ATGE shares took a beating on Tuesday, falling almost 19% after Safkhet Capital Research went short on the company. And according to Ihor Dusaniwsky, managing director of predictive analytics at S3 Partners, many companies in the education services sub-industry could see a surge in short selling activity, with Adtalem leading the pack.
Many stocks in the sector have been facing similar price weakness, with language learning platform Duolingo DUOL and educational service provider New Oriental Education & Technology Group
EDU among others being the largest shorts in the sector.
Dusaniwsky notes that in the last thirty days, the sector has seen a net increase of $18 million in short selling, with Duolingo, Adtalem, and Grand Canyon Education LOPE having the largest increase of short selling.
Company-Short selling | Short interest as a percentage of free float shares | Short interest | 30-day change shares shorted |
Duolingo | 6.25% | $416.28 mln | $23.66 mln |
Adtalem Global Education Inc | 3.36% | $76.58 mln | $17.13 mln |
Grand Canyon Education Inc | 1.67% | $63.56 mln | $11.88 mln |
Bright Horizons Family Solutions | 3.61% | $208.92 mln | $9.55 mln |
Udemy Inc | 6.29% | $67.99 mln | $5.97 mln |
On the flipside, Tal Education Group TAL, Chegg Inc
CHGG and Coursera Inc
COUR have seen the most short covering this past month.
Company-Short covering | Short interest as a percentage of free float shares | Short interest | 30-day change shares shorted |
Tal Education Group | 5.55% | $290.31 mln | ($44.48 mln) |
Chegg Inc | 13.31% | $151.16 mln | ($17.79 mln) |
Coursera | 4.59% | $106.57 mln | ($14.31 mln) |
Laureate Education Inc | 3.60% | $60.46 mln | ($9.10 mln) |
Gaotu Techedu Inc | 8.85% | $42.29 mln | ($4.99 mln) |
